Transaction 3ad80f4163b79ebd07e663b1f8c348b511278591a0151f443e54547ad528dc52
1 Input
1 Output
-
3ad80f4163b79ebd07e663b1f8c348b511278591a0151f443e54547ad528dc52:0
- value
- 595823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f701c33e1b0cf1da46c5de5007600de5475378a OP_EQUAL
- address
- 34ZFB3MeFwqTxrA4ZndzWvr2Zq7tfgyPKo